2

Как можно мгновенно отключить функцию блокировки экрана в Windows XP?

Я попытался импортировать это в регистр:

Windows Registry Editor Version 5.00

[H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Policies\System]
"DisableLockWorkstation"=dword:00000001

[H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Policies\System]
"DisableLockWorkstation"=dword:00000001

Но это не работает, и пользователь все еще может заблокировать компьютер.
Я попробовал это на Windows 7, и он неожиданно работает отлично!

Примечание: я знаю, что это легко сделать с помощью gpedit.msc и редактирования параметров групповой политики, но мне нужно решение, которое можно сделать программно легко (например, изменение реестра).

Примечание 2: решение должно немедленно отключить / включить функцию блокировки. Для вступления в силу не нужно выходить из системы или перезагружаться. Редактирование реестра работает нормально и сразу в Win7, но не работает в моей Windows XP.

ОБНОВЛЕНИЕ: я выяснил, когда я отключаю функцию Fast User Switching , проблема решается, и я могу мгновенно отключить / включить функцию Lock (способ реестра).

Но вопрос остается в силе, когда Fast User Switching не отключено.

2 ответа2

1

Это ошибка в XP. Они утверждали, что это будет исправлено:

Эта проблема была впервые исправлена в Microsoft Windows XP с пакетом обновления 2 (SP2).

Либо это не было исправлено, либо они впоследствии вновь сломали его. У меня есть коробка SP3 XP здесь, и она не работает. У них есть исправление, которое вы можете загрузить, но оно не будет установлено, потому что оно старше установленного в данный момент файла. Если вы хотите попробовать это сами, вот ссылка на статью базы знаний:

Вы можете заблокировать компьютер, даже если в Windows XP действует параметр «Отключить блокировку рабочей станции»

0

Эта проблема решается путем отключения функции Fast-User-Switching . возможно это кажется неловким и не связанным, но на самом деле есть причина!

Когда Fast-User-Switiching включен, другие пользователи должны Lock этот пользователь , чтобы начать новый сеанс и войти в системе . Поэтому бессмысленно отказывать в разрешении Lock при включенном FUS .

Таким образом, любой, кто хочет отключить Lock , также забудет о FUS и отключит его.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.